Christians are called to live with integrity and honor, even in difficult environments.Paul teaches that governing authorities exist under God's authority. This does not mean every leader is perfect or every decision is right. But it does mean God is still sovereign over human systems. For early Christians living under the Roman Empire, this was challenging. Rome was often corrupt and hostile toward believers. Yet Paul encourages Christians to live honorably, peacefully, and with integrity.Followers of Jesus are called to reflect God even within imperfect systems.
